Adobe FreeHand was a vector graphics editor and designer software for creating illustrations, layouts and typography. It was developed by Macromedia and later acquired by Adobe Systems.

Inkscape is a free and open-source vector graphics editor designed for creating and editing vector graphics such as illustrations, icons, logos, diagrams, and more. It supports a wide range of file formats and is known for its powerful set of drawing tools and features.
